Effect of Glyburide on Glycemic Control, Insulin Requirement, and Glucose Metabolism in Insulin-Treated Diabetic Patients

Glycemic control and glucose metabolism were examined in 5 patients with insulin-dependent diabetes mellitus (IDDM) and 8 insulin-treated non-insulin-dependent diabetes mellitus (NIDDM) patients before and after 2 mo of therapy with glyburide (20 mg/day). Glycemic control was assessed by daily insulin requirement, 24-h plasma glucose profile, glucosuria, and glycosylated hemoglobin. Insulin secretion was evaluated by glucagon stimulation of C-peptide secretion, and insulin sensitivity was determined by a two-step euglycemic insulin clamp (1 and 10 mU X kg-1. X min-1) performed with indirect calorimetry and [3-3H]glucose. In the IDDM patients, the addition of glyburide produced no change in daily insulin dose (54 +/- 8 vs. 53 +/- 7 U/day), mean 24-h glucose level (177 +/- 20 vs. 174 +/- 29 mg/dl), glucosuria (20 +/- 6 vs. 35 +/- 12 g/day) or glycosylated hemoglobin (10.1 +/- 1.0 vs. 9.5 +/- 0.7%). Furthermore, there was no improvement in basal hepatic glucose production (2.1 +/- 0.2 vs. 2.4 +/- 0.1 mg X kg-1 X min-1), suppression of hepatic glucose production by low- and high-dose insulin infusion, or in any measure of total, oxidative, or nonoxidative glucose metabolism in the basal state or during insulin infusion. C-peptide levels were undetectable (less than 0.01 pmol/ml) in the basal state and after glucagon infusion and remained undetectable after glyburide therapy. In contrast to the IDDM patients, the insulin-treated NIDDM subjects exhibited significant reductions in daily insulin requirement (72 +/- 6 vs. 58 +/- 9 U/day), mean 24-h plasma glucose concentration (153 +/- 10 vs. 131 +/- 5 mg/dl), glucosuria (14 +/- 5 vs. 4 +/- 1 g/day), and glycosylated hemoglobin (10.3 +/- 0.7 vs. 8.0 +/- 0.4%) after glyburide treatment (all P less than or equal to .05). However, there was no change in basal hepatic glucose production (1.7 +/- 0.1 vs. 1.7 +/- 0.1 mg X kg-1 X min-1), suppression of hepatic glucose production by insulin, or insulin sensitivity during the two-step insulin-clamp study. Both basal (0.14 +/- 0.05 vs. 0.32 +/- 0.05 pmol/ml, P less than .05) and glucagon-stimulated (0.24 +/- 0.07 vs. 0.44 +/- 0.09 pmol/ml) C-peptide levels rose after 2 mo of glyburide therapy and both were correlated with the decrease in insulin requirement (basal: r = .65, P = .08; glucagon stimulated: r = .93, P less than .001).(ABSTRACT TRUNCATED AT 400 WORDS)
